The cheapest way to get from Colnbrook to East Ham is to drive which costs £6 - £10 and takes 1h 3m.
The fastest way to get from Colnbrook to East Ham is to drive which takes 1h 3m and costs £6 - £10.
No, there is no direct bus from Colnbrook to East Ham. However, there are services departing from Ye Olde George Inn and arriving at Bartle Avenue via Nene Road and Charing Cross.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 49m.
The distance between Colnbrook and East Ham is 29 miles. The road distance is 27 miles.
The best way to get from Colnbrook to East Ham without a car is to train and subway which takes 1h 19m and costs £22 - £70.
It takes approximately 1h 19m to get from Colnbrook to East Ham, including transfers.
Colnbrook to East Ham bus services, operated by Metroline Travel, depart from Nene Road station.
Colnbrook to East Ham bus services, operated by Metroline Travel, arrive at Charing Cross station.
Yes, the driving distance between Colnbrook to East Ham is 27 miles. It takes approximately 1h 3m to drive from Colnbrook to East Ham.
